RussellGrant.com Video Horoscope Leo July Thursday 26th

RussellGrant.com Video Horoscope Leo July Thursday 26th

Leo Daily Horoscope for Thursday 26th July from


User: Russell Grant

Views: 8

Uploaded: 2012-07-26

Duration: 00:32